2008 Suzuki Jimny vs. 2005 Toyota Matrix

To start off, 2008 Suzuki Jimny is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Toyota Matrix.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Toyota Matrix would be higher. At 1,793 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Toyota Matrix is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Toyota Matrix (129 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 44 more horse power than 2008 Suzuki Jimny. (85 HP @ 3750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Toyota Matrix should accelerate faster than 2008 Suzuki Jimny.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Suzuki Jimny weights approximately 110 kg more than 2005 Toyota Matrix.

Because 2008 Suzuki Jimny is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Toyota Matrix.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Suzuki Jimny will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Suzuki Jimny (200 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 33 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Toyota Matrix. (167 Nm @ 4200 RPM). This means 2008 Suzuki Jimny will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Toyota Matrix.

Compare all specifications:

2008 Suzuki Jimny 2005 Toyota Matrix
Make Suzuki Toyota
Model Jimny Matrix
Year Released 2008 2005
Body Type SUV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1461 cc 1793 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 85 HP 129 HP
Engine RPM 3750 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 200 Nm 167 Nm
Torque RPM 1750 RPM 4200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 76 mm 79 mm
Engine Stroke Size 80.5 mm 91.5 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 17.9:1 10.0:1
Fuel Type Diesel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1230 kg 1120 kg
Vehicle Length 3650 mm 4360 mm
Vehicle Width 1610 mm 1780 mm
Vehicle Height 1680 mm 1550 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 2860 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 6.1 L/100km 7.1 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 40 L 50 L
